About

Transcranial Doppler is performed daily in Intensive Care Unit in brain damaged patients. For a few years now, the measurement of the photomotor reflex by quantitative Pupillometry has been routinely performed in Intensive Care Units. The objective of this work is to see if Transcranial Doppler recorded parameters and Pupillary parameters are correlated to the neurological prognosis evaluated at 9 months by the Modified Rankin Score (mRS) and the Glasgow Outcome Scale Extended (GOS-E).

Trial design

73 participants in 1 patient group

brain damaged patients
Description:
All major brain damaged patients (stroke or head trauma) admitted to reanimation will be included. In the usual practice, they have a Transcranial Doppler and the measurement of the photomotor reflex by quantitative Pupillometry. It is planned to collect the simultaneous values of the different parameters during 2,000 measurements. The data will be collected retrospectively from 01/12/2020, and prospectively from 01/04/2021.
